Optical sensors are devices that convert light energy into electric signals. Photointerrupters are an example of optical sensors. They use a phototransistor to detect the presence and absence of light. The EE-SX1041 is a slot type transistor output photointerrupter, which is used in a variety of applications. This article will discuss the application field and working principle of the EE-SX1041.
Application field
The EE-SX1041 is a wide-slot type transistor output photointerrupter, meaning it detects the presence or absence of objects which are wider than the gaps in traditional types. This makes it suited for applications that require detection of objects which are wider than the gaps in traditional types.
Some of the applications the EE-SX1041 is suitable for include detection of paper money and other broad objects, accurate positioning of rotary devices, motions of conveyor belts, security systems, and quality assurance operations. This photointerrupter is also suitable for measuring the speed and direction of rotation of cylindrical objects, offering precise measurements even in difficult conditions.
Working Principle
The EE-SX1041 operates under a dynamic response principle. The basic components used in the EE-SX1041 are an LED, an optical detecting element, and a collector. The LED emits infrared light, which is transmitted into an optical path. When an object passes through the path, the LED light is blocked thereby changing the voltage applied to the collector. This change in voltage is converted to an electric signal and the signal is used as an input to the controller.
